Product Description:
Widely used as a powerful oxidizing agent in organic synthesis, enabling selective oxidation of alcohols, phenols, and thiols. Commonly applied in the preparation of fine chemicals and pharmaceuticals where controlled oxidation is critical. Also employed in analytical chemistry for redox titrations due to its stable and well-defined oxidation potential. Used in electrochemical processes and as a catalyst in certain polymerization reactions. Its strong oxidizing nature makes it suitable for surface treatment of metals and in some etching processes. Additionally, finds use in the synthesis of nanomaterials and metal oxides, where it acts as a precursor for cerium-based compounds.
